In the rear seat, you may have trouble tightening the
lap/shoulder belt on the child restraint because the
buckle or latch plate is too close to the belt path opening
on the restraint. Disconnect the latch plate from the
buckle and twist the short buckle-end belt several times
to shorten it. Insert the latch plate into the buckle with the
release button facing out.

If the belt still can’t be tightened, or if pulling and
pushing on the restraint loosens the belt, you may need
to do something more. Disconnect the latch plate from
the buckle, turn the buckle around, and insert the latch
plate into the buckle again. If you still can’t make the
child restraint secure, try a different seating position.

To attach a child restraint tether strap:

1. If lowered, raise the convertible top.

NOTE:

The convertible top must be in the UP position

to access the tether anchor.

2. Open the access port cover (A) behind the seat where
you are placing the child restraint.

3. Push the tether strap and hook (B) through the access
port and down into the trunk.

NOTE:

Route the tether strap to provide the most direct

path from the child seat to the anchor.
